Output 3d075a35a10915571853e1fa9e86a11ae076c4be39f7ef5393b8c98ee41f21dd:2

value
628434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37781ae775bec0efb08876fc4a16b2235ba11e2 OP_EQUAL
address
3NRkUYvVVcoX8cPeKt73fBwLoh6St1LLQo
transaction
3d075a35a10915571853e1fa9e86a11ae076c4be39f7ef5393b8c98ee41f21dd
spent
true